English version

mode of payment

From Longman Business Dictionarymode of paymentˌmode of ˈpayment (plural modes of payment) a particular way of paying for something SYN METHOD OF PAYMENT mode
Pictures of the day
Do you know what each of these is called?
Click on the pictures to check.
Word of the day consequently as a result